Is Carnauba Wax Halal?

Also known as: E903, Brazil wax, Palm wax

Detailed Explanation

Carnauba wax is a plant-derived wax from the carnauba palm (Copernicia prunifera). It is one of the hardest natural waxes and is used as a glazing and polishing agent. It is always halal as it is entirely plant-based.

How to Identify

Listed as 'carnauba wax', 'E903', 'Brazil wax', or 'palm wax'.
